North America Nucleic Acid Test Kits for NG, CT and UU Market

Nucleic Acid Test (NAT) kits for Neisseria gonorrhoeae (NG), Chlamydia trachomatis (CT), and Ureaplasma urealyticum (UU) play a crucial role in diagnostic testing within the North America. These kits are essential for the detection of these sexually transmitted infections (STIs), providing accurate and reliable results that aid in timely treatment and prevention efforts.

NG, CT, and UU NAT kits are typically categorized based on their target pathogens and detection methods. Polymerase chain reaction (PCR) and nucleic acid amplification tests (NAATs) are commonly used technologies due to their high sensitivity and specificity in detecting genetic material from these microorganisms. These kits are designed to detect specific DNA or RNA sequences unique to NG, CT, or UU, ensuring precise identification.
